François Jourda is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ery and Internal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, François Jourda has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 432 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 3 papers in Surgery and 3 papers in Internal Medicine. Recurrent topics in François Jourda's work include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(6 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(6 papers) and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(3 papers). François Jourda is often cited by papers focused on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(6 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(6 papers) and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(3 papers). François Jourda collaborates with scholars based in France, Czechia and Belgium. François Jourda's co-authors include Serge Bovéda, Rui Providência, Éloi Marijon, Nicolas Combes, Stéphane Combes, J.-P. Albenque, Ziad Khoueiry, Christelle Cardin, Abdeslam Bouzeman and Jean Paul Albenque and has published in prestigious journals such as European Heart Journal, EP Europace and Heart & Lung.
